CleanPlay Launches on PlayStation 5 with Rewards from 2K

Players can now earn in-game rewards while supporting real-world renewable energy

SAN FRANCISCO (Mar. 27, 2025) Starting today, CleanPlay is helping put the energy transition directly into the hands of players with the launch of its new app on PlayStation 5, connecting gamers with ongoing investments in renewable energy. Founded by games industry pioneers David Helgason and Richard Hilleman, CleanPlay is a new subscription platform that matches the average electricity used by gaming consoles with verified clean energy solutions. In an initial partnership with leading game publisher 2K, CleanPlay subscribers will earn exclusive in-game rewards, including XP boosts, virtual currency and special content in PGA TOUR 2K and TopSpin 2K25.
 
Players in the U.S. can now download CleanPlay on PlayStation 5 and seamlessly select which U.S.-based clean energy projects they want to support, helping drive investment in wind, solar, geothermal and other emerging energy technologies. Through Renewable Energy Certificates (RECs)—a widely recognized tool that supports more clean power production—CleanPlay is helping to make gaming a force for energy investment and grid modernization.

Some measures show that player energy consumption accounts for approximately 80% of console emissions, making it the most significant contributor to the games industry’s carbon footprint. While CleanPlay cannot erase emissions resulting from each player’s personal energy use, the impact is real—each subscription drives up demand for clean energy, building toward a future where clean power is the standard.

CleanPlay is exploring ways to scale its clean energy initiatives, including supporting new projects through Virtual Power Purchase Agreements (VPPAs)—a mechanism for directly financing renewable energy development. Looking ahead, CleanPlay envisions a future where a Virtual Power Plant (VPP) enables the gaming community to help accelerate clean energy adoption at scale.

About 2K Games
Founded in 2005, 2K develops and publishes interactive entertainment for video game consoles, personal computers, and mobile devices, with product availability including physical retail and digital download. The Company is home to many talented development studios, including 31st Union, Cat Daddy Games, Cloud Chamber, Firaxis Games, Gearbox Software, Hangar 13, HB Studios, and Visual Concepts. 2K’s portfolio currently includes several AAA, sports, and entertainment brands, including global powerhouse NBA® 2K; renowned BioShock®, Borderlands®, Mafia, Sid Meier’s Civilization® and XCOM® brands; popular WWE® 2K and WWE® SuperCard franchises, TopSpin® as well as the critically and commercially acclaimed PGA TOUR® 2K. Additional information about 2K and its products may be found at 2K.com and on the Company’s official social media channels.
2K is a publishing label of Take-Two Interactive Software, Inc. (NASDAQ: TTWO).
